Output 63caa3ca866d29ac8d720a5111babe320a1abc0c0377bbb5024b1b0464b75bec:9

value
5447853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f026baffdab1236f8ba896ac7328f05c987415 OP_EQUAL
address
3ESwYDGm5cB2cimyNXrdeMTcMXzdWyVD5h
transaction
63caa3ca866d29ac8d720a5111babe320a1abc0c0377bbb5024b1b0464b75bec
confirmations
216393
spent
true